REDESAIN RAKEL DAN PEMBERIAN PEREGANGAN AKTIF MENURUNKAN BEBAN KERJA DAN KELUHAN MUSKULOSKELETAL SERTA MENINGKATKAN PRODUKTIVITAS KERJA PEKERJA SABLON PADA INDUSTRI SABLON SURYA BALI DI DENPASAR Daryono . .; I Dewa Putu Sutjana; I Made Muliarta

Abstract

Problems ergonomics in industrial screen printing traditional fabrics such as work attitude unnatural causing musculoskeletal disorders in workers printing. To overcome these problems, especially for fabric printing activity done by redesigning Rakel research and giving active stretching. The purpose of this study was to know the effects of the using redesigning Rakel and active stretching for the fabric screen printing workers to decrease the workload, musculoskeletal disorders and increased work productivity. The study design is the design of the same subject, involving 12 workers printing male, 20-45 years old, between 1-5 years of work experience. Research into two phases. The first phase (I) subjects treated with Rakel without redesigning work and without giving active stretching. The second phase (II) subjects treated with redesigning work Rakel and giving active stretching. Among the two phases of the study, given a wash out period for 2 days and adaptation redesigning Rakel for 4 days, to eliminate carry-over effects. The workload is measured by the method of pulse 10 beats, musculoskeletal complaints measured by a questionnaire Nordic Body Map at 4 Likert scale and work productivity based on the ratio between output and input. Data were analyzed with the Shapiro-Wilk test to determine the normality of the data, paired t-test to test the significance difference variable workload and productivity of work at the significance level ? = 0.05 and Wilcoxon test for variables musculoskeletal complaints. The results showed that redesigning Rakel and provision of active stretching can reduce the workload of 30,3% (p<0.05) and lower musculoskeletal complaints by 16,9% (p<0.05) as well as increasing work productivity by 45,5% (p <0.05). It concluded that the redesign Rakel and provision of active stretching can reduce the workload and musculoskeletal disorders and increase productivity for workers printing. Suggested to the owner of a similar business industry to make good working conditions referring to ergonomic principles, so as to create safer working conditions, comfortable, healthy and productive workers.
PENGGUNAAN REDESAIN BANTAL MENYUSUI MENINGKATKAN MOTIVASI IBU MENYUSUI DAN KEPUASAN BAYI SERTA MENGURANGI KELELAHAN DAN KELUHAN MUSKULOSKELETAL IBU POST PARTUM Ni Wayan Muliarthini; I Dewa Putu Sutjana; I Putu Gede Adiatmika

Abstract

Breastfeeding is a very important activity for both mother and baby. In the breastfeeding state the relationship between mother and baby will be tight and close. The old method and also duration of breastfeeding can cause fatigue, shoulder muscle tension, and soreness / stiffness in breastfeeding mothers. Problems due to absence of the use of pillow when mother breastfeed and mothers only depending on her limb to sustain baby when breastfeeding. In this case we need an ergonomic pillow to help mother feeding her baby. The purpose of this research is to investigate the use of redesigning nursing pillow can reduce fatigue, musculoskeletal complaints in breastfeeding mothers, to determine the use redesigning nursing pillow increase the motivation of mothers to breastfeed the baby as well as increase the satisfaction of nursing infants.This research held in as an experimental research draft of pre and post control group design. Samples that were included in this study was 22 people divided into two groups. The control group will breastfeeding using older model nursing pillow, while the another group will use the new redesign nursing pillow. Data analysis using t-test paried significance level of 5%.The result showed mother’s motivation after breastfeeding in both groups increased, the control group (18.27 ± 2.370) and the treatment group (15.45 ± 1.809). Baby satisfaction in the control group (11.09 ± 0.943), while the treatment group (12.27 ± 0.904). Exhausted mother’s in the control group (39.64 ± 2.803), while the treatment group (32.64 ± 1.504).Musculoskeletal disorders that mother’s felt in the control group (37.54 ± 1.694), while the treatment group (30.81 ± 2.136).Based on the study can be concluded that redesign breastfeeding pillow can giving impact to increase motivation and baby satisfaction and also decrease fatigue and musculoskeletal complain/disorder that mothers can feel. So hopefully by using this nursing pillow design maximizes mothers to breastfeed
ANALISIS BEBAN KERJA PETANI PADA PENGOLAHAN LAHAN STROBERI DI KABUPATEN TABANAN M. Yusuf .; Nyoman Adiputra .; I Dewa Putu Sutjana; Ketut Tirtayasa .

Abstract

Bedugul is a village in Tabanan regency that produce strawberry. Bedugul is famous tourist area not only in Bali or Indonesia, are even known in the world. . In the process of planting strawberries, farmers cultivate land by making raised beds (bedeng) beforehand, add fertilizer, coat beds with mulch, and make a hole in the plastic mulch. there are problems in the processing of these strawberry fields, such as the musculoskeletal disorder and general fatigue. This research was conducted observational against 12 strawberry farmers in Bedugul Tabanan regency. The workload is predicted by calculated the pulse that measured by ten pulse methode in artery radialis use a stopwatch. Ambient temperature and humidity are measured with a sling psychrometer.  Wind speed is measured using the anemometer. Temperature heat of solar radiation measured with a thermometer bulb. General fatigue predicted by 30 item questioners about fatigue with 4 Likert scale. Musculoskeletal disorders predicted by Nordic Body Map. ECPT (extra calorie due to peripheral temperature) and ECPM (extra calorie due to peripheral metabolism) is calculated based on the pulse restore of the farmers. The results of this research concluded that: (1) Workload strawberry farmers categories of heavy workload, (2) There are significant differences in the score of subjective disorder of farmers (musculoskeletal disorder and general fatigue) before and after work, (3) The value of ECPM higher than ECPT so that to improve the activity of the farmers can be done through the task of strawberry farmers (4) score RULA analysis values obtained grand score of 7, that is mean investigation and change are required immediately. It is therefore recommended to immediate improvement in the work of the strawberry farmers
HUBUNGAN BEBAN OTOT TANGAN AKTIVITAS PENGETIKAN NASKAH BALI DENGAN KEYBOARD QWERTY TERHADAP HASIL BELAJAR I KG Suhartana; N Adiputra .; K Tirtayasa .; I Dewa Putu Sutjana

Abstract

As a human tools, computer is used in various sectors of human life, for examples: writing documents, playing  multimedia  and so on.  Making document withBalinese charactersusing a computer has many obstacles such as letters, points, and sign in Balinese charactershave different forms with letters, points, and sign in alphabetic. Another difficulty is the keyboard that is commonly used is not specific to type Balinese script. This research was aimed to determine the correlation between a decrease of  hand muscles load activity typing Balinese scripts with QWERTY keyboard on the increase in learning outcomes. This research was done by using descriptive correlation. Samplesof this research were 23 students who meet the inclusion and exclusion criteria were selectedrandomly. The correlation test results showed that there is a strong correlation between a decrease hand muscle load with the learning outcomes of r xy = -0.963 and p = 0.001. This shows that there is a significant correlation between a decrease hand muscle load with increase learning outcomes with p <0.05. There is a strong correlation and significant between a decrease hand muscle load with increase learning outcomes on Balinese typing activity usingQWERTYkeyboard
TINGKAT BEBAN KERJA PERAJIN GAMELAN BALI I Ketut Gde Juli Suarbawa; Nyoman Adiputra .; I Dewa Sutjana; Ketut Tirtayasa .

Abstract

The production process of making gamelan in the village Tihingan, Klungkung, Bali, still using the traditional fireplace with open flames both to the melting process as well as on the process of formation so that crafters fairly heavy workload caused by exposure to radiation heat and dust. This research was conducted observational against 5 people workers (craftsman) gamelan nguwad process. The workload is measured by pulse craftsman work. Microclimate in the workplace were measured wet temperature, dry temperature, humidity, intensity of noise, and light intensity. Musculoskeletal disorderpredicted by questioner of Nordic Body Map and general fatigue  predicted  by  the questioner 30 items exhaustion with four Likert scale. The results of the research to get the pulse of gamelan craftsmen working on a furnace repairman 116.25 ± 3.78, the flop workers 115.42 ± 2.47, and 3.29 ± 126.47 of nguwad workers. The cardio vasculer load obtained 50.13 ± 3.42% so the recommended 75% work and 25% rest. Gamelan making production process also cause a variety of subjective disorders. It was concluded that (a) the level of workload on a craftsman gamelan is the artisan perapen and artisan-flops belonging to the workload being, the artisan nguwad workload is quite heavy, (b) based on the value of CVL, workload craftsman gamelan in Bali including the workload being, ( c) a significant increase in musculoskeletal disorder and general fatigue. To overcome this condition it is recommended that the working process of making gamelan remedied through the implementing appropriate technology and ergonomics intervention.
PENGGUNAAN TANGKAI PEGANGAN ROLLER CAT YANG DIMODIFIKASI MENINGKATKAN KINERJA PENGECAT PLAFON RUKAN DI DENPASAR I Gusti Agung Haryawan; I Dewa Putu Sutjana; I Made Sutajaya

Abstract

Buildings development is very glowing recently.  This also has effect on manpower who works at this sector.  Manpower is demanded to have skill according to his field.  Worker at finishing field or especially for ceiling painter needs skill and technique that he should master.  While working the worker always assists by tools and paint materials.  Tools that are used by the ceiling painter have not been refered to antropometry aspect, so it can cause inconvenient in performing the job.  Working with toold that are not accorded to ergonomic principle and working posture that is not physiological can cause fatigue, muscle disturbance, musculoskeletal and increasing working load.  That is why it needs to modify painting roller holder stick.  In that case the worker can work in comfort, safe, healthy, efficient and productive so it can increase productivity. This research was perfomed at office house at Denpasar City.  Type of this research is experimental research by using treatment by subject design by involving 16 samples.  Interval between before treatment and after treatment is given washing out for two days.  Data measured are the working load measured by the increasing of subjective complaint recorded by Nordic Body Map questionnaire, pulses, fatigue and working productivity.  Data of subjective complaint was analyzed by non-parametric statistic test using the Wilcoxon test with significance rate of ? = 0.05, data of pulses as indicator of working load,  working productivity was priorly data normality tested by Shapiro-Wilk Test with significance rate of ? = 0.05.  Data that normal distributed is continued with parametric statistic test using the t-paired test at significance rate of ? = 0.05. Research result shows that there is significant different (p<0.05) to working load variable, musculoskeletal complaint, fatigue and productivity.  At before treatment the average of pulses of ceiling painter is 118.95 + 2.30 dpm, average of musculoskeletal complaint is 78.50 + 5.84, average of fatigue is 74.22 + 388 and average of productivity is 0,070 + 0,017.  Whereas, at after treatment the average of pulses of ceiling painter is 111.89 + 6.58 dpm, average of musculoskeletal complaint is 61.61 + 1.71, average of fatigue is 64.50 + 2.88 and average of productivity is 0,086 + 0,070. Modification of painting roller holder stick turned out to decrease working load for 10,77%, musculoskeletal complaint for 21,51%, fatigue for 13,09%, and productivity is increasing for 22,85%. From discussion above it can be concluded that the modification of painting roller holder stick can decrease working load, musculoskeletal complaint, fatigue, and increase productivity.  In that case, it can be expected that the ceiling painter workers use this painting roller holder stick in order to minimize any complaint raises due to working process
